AUSTRALIAN NEWS.

[PBESS ASSOCIATION.]

RUBIES AND GOLD.

Adelaide, January 14. Eight hundred and sixty men are afc present engaged gathering rubies ovei a large area in the Alice Springs dis trict, while many others are working on a good, goldfield. A FRAUDULENT MAYOR. Brisbane, January 14. John Wallis Rutter, Mayor of North Rockhampton, who was arrested on £ charge of forgery, and who attempted to commit suicide in prison, has been committed for trial. The forgeries have been ascertained to amount to £9500.

THE MINING BOOM. Melbourne, January 14. The excitement in the sharemarket continues, and yesterday half a million pounds worth of stock changed hands. THE PACIFIC CABLE. Melbourne, January 14. Sir Graham Berry, Agent-General, wires to the Government that the Admiralty are willing to survey the route of the proposed Pacific cable if the colonies will bear the cost.

DEFRAUDING THE CUSTOMS. Brisbane, January 14. Joseph Levy, who had just arrived from Paris, has been fined £400 for . landing precious stones at Thursday Island, on which the duty had not beei paid.

THE CENTENNIAL CELEBRATIONS. Sydney, January 14. The proposal to change the name of the colony, as well aa the intention to erect a State House, have, it is underetood, been abandoned; also the proposed Centennial Musical Festival. Melbourne, January 14. Two hundred riflemen will go to Sydney from this colony to take part in the shooting contest in connection with the Centennial.

Wellington , , Sunday. Sir William Fitzherbert will attend tbe Centennial demonstration in Sydney on the 26th instant in his capacity as Speaker of tbe Legislative Council, and will express to the Government of New South Wales the regret of the New Zealand Government that no minister of this colony can be present.
